Importance of Pre-Trip Inspections

A pre-trip inspection is a comprehensive check-up of your vehicle conducted by experienced professionals to identify any potential issues that could compromise your safety on the road. Here are some key reasons why pre-trip inspections are essential:

  • Safety: Ensuring that your vehicle is in good working condition can help prevent breakdowns and accidents on the road.
  • Reliability: A well-maintained vehicle is less likely to encounter unexpected issues that could derail your travel plans.
  • Cost-Effectiveness: Addressing minor issues during a pre-trip inspection can prevent them from snowballing into major and costly problems later on.

What Does a Pre-Trip Inspection Include?

When you bring your vehicle to Western Auto Service in Boise, Idaho, for a pre-trip inspection, our team of skilled technicians will conduct a thorough assessment of various components, including:

  • Tire Condition: Checking tire pressure, tread depth, and overall condition to ensure optimal traction and performance.
  • Fluid Levels: Inspecting and topping up essential fluids such as oil, coolant, brake fluid, and windshield washer fluid.
  • Brake System: Checking brake pads, rotors, and brake fluid levels to ensure your vehicle can come to a stop safely.
  • Battery Health: Testing the battery’s charge and assessing its overall condition to prevent unexpected breakdowns.
  • Lights and Signals: Verifying that all lights, including headlights, taillights, turn signals, and brake lights, are functioning properly.
  • Belts and Hoses: Inspecting belts and hoses for signs of wear and tear that could lead to malfunctions.
  • Suspension and Steering: Checking the suspension system and steering components to ensure a smooth and controlled ride.
